乌梅丸对溃疡性结肠炎大鼠结肠组织NF-κB p65的影响  被引量:18

Effect of Wumeiwan on NF-κB p65 in colon tissue of rats with ulcerative colitis

摘  要:目的:比较乌梅丸与西药柳氮磺胺吡啶SASP组对溃疡性结肠炎大鼠结肠组织NF-κB p65疗效的大小,并分析其作用机制.方法:应用2,4.二硝基氯苯(DNCB)免疫加醋酸局部灌肠法建立UC大鼠模型,将56只健康SD大鼠(雌雄各半),按雌雄随机分4组,分别为乌梅丸组、SASP组、模型组和正常组,分别观察治疗后大鼠结肠黏膜组织匀浆NF-κB p65的变化.结果:在正常结肠组织中NF-κB p65无或仅有弱阳性表达,模型组结肠黏膜组织NF-κB p65阳性细胞表达率明显高于正常组(45.67%±4.25%vs 10.45%±5.20%,P<0.05),乌梅丸(26.32%±9.65%)和SASP(31.23%±5.18%)组阳性细胞率则明显低于模型组,乌梅丸组阳性细胞率较SASP组更低.结论:NF-κB与UC发病关系密切,乌梅丸可能通过抑制NF-κB p65活性调节免疫功能达到治疗的目的.AIM: To compare the effects of Wumeiwan (WMW) and solfasalazine (SASP) on NF-κB p65 in colon tissue of rats with ulcerative colitis (UC) and to analyze their mechanism of action. METHODS: A model of UC was induced by administration of dinitro-chlorobenzene (DNCB) and acetic acid. Fifty-six SD rats (28 males and 28 females) were randomly divided into normal control group (n = 14), model group (n = 14), SASP group (n = 14), and WMW group (n = 14). Changes of NF-κB p65 in rat colon tissue were observed after treatment with DNCB and acetic acid. RESULTS: NF-κB p65 was not expressed or weakly expressed in normal colon tissue. The positive expression rate of NF-κB p65 was significantly higher in WMW and SASP groups than in normal control group(26.32% ± 9.65%, 31.23% ± 5.18% vs 45.67% ±4.2%, P 〈 0.01). The positive expression rate of NF-κB p65 was significantly lower in WMW group than in model group. There were significant differences between WMW and SASP groups (P 〈 0.05). CONCLUSION: NF-κB is closely related with the development of UC. WMW can treat UC by suppressing the activity of NF-κB p65.
